Mechanical Properties of Polypropylene Composite Reinforced with Oil Palm Empty Fruit Bunch Pulp

In this study, oil palm empty fruit bunch (EFB) pulp Was used as reinforcing agent in polypropylene composite. EFB pulp was prepared using soda pulping with different concentrations of sodium hydroxide (NaOH) solution. Overall, the tensile and flexural properties specifically the strength and the toughness showed improvement as the NaOH content in the treatment was increased. This was attributed to lower probability for EFB Pulp to agglomerate and the production Of higher aspect ratio pulp fibers. Scanning electron microscopy analysis showed evidence of the reduction ill EFB bundles diameter after NaOH treatment.
